A Journey into the Heart of Nature
As someone who has spent years advocating for sustainable tourism, I am always on the lookout for experiences that allow travelers to connect with nature while preserving its beauty. The Mount Aspiring Funyak and Jet Boat Adventure was one such experience that promised an eco-friendly exploration of the UNESCO World Heritage-listed Mount Aspiring National Park. The journey began with a scenic coach ride to Glenorchy, a quaint town nestled at the northern end of Lake Wakatipu. The anticipation built as we approached the starting point of our adventure, surrounded by the breathtaking landscapes that have become synonymous with New Zealand’s natural allure.
Upon arrival, we were greeted by the friendly team who provided us with all the necessary gear, including wetsuits, shoes, and rain jackets. Their commitment to ensuring a comfortable and safe experience was evident, and I appreciated the attention to detail, even providing sunscreen and insect repellent. As we prepared for the jet boat ride, I couldn’t help but feel a sense of excitement mixed with a deep appreciation for the pristine environment we were about to explore.
The Thrill of the Jet Boat and Funyak
The jet boat ride was nothing short of exhilarating. For 45 minutes, we sped through the crystal-clear waters of the Dart River, surrounded by towering mountains and lush forests. The landscape was reminiscent of the ‘Middle-earth’ countryside from ‘The Lord of the Rings,’ and I found myself lost in the sheer beauty of it all. The jet boat’s speed and agility allowed us to access parts of the river that would otherwise be unreachable, offering a unique perspective on this untouched world.
Transitioning from the jet boat to the funyak was an adventure in itself. Our guide provided a thorough briefing on how to maneuver the inflatable canoe, emphasizing the differences from traditional kayaking. While the pace was brisk, it was manageable, and the sense of camaraderie among the group added to the experience. Paddling through hidden side streams and exploring the dramatic chasm was a highlight, offering a sense of peace and tranquility that is often hard to find in our fast-paced world.
